SECOND ISSUE OF Costume Journal 2009 OUT AT THE AGM, NOV. 2008


Outstanding content came with Vol. 38 Number 2 of the Costume Journal, received by all CSO members late November. News of exhibitions and events, feature articles, member profile, event and book reviews, plus resources lists—much to interest the costume and textile enthusiast.

One special item of news in the Fall issue was the publication of CSO’s first wall calendar, and it is not too far into the year to pick this up!  Each month an original fashion print is shown, the earliest from 1770, the latest 1880, with commentary by Sarah Walker.  The prints are in the colours of the originals, inks added by colourists working with the printers, since techniques did not allow colour printing. The calendar opens to 17″ long by 11″ wide, with poster stock paper, and coil-bound pages—a delightful, high quality costume addition to your year.
